Situation:

Hughenden Court, the sought-after 60 and over retirement development enjoys an advantageous location being tucked away in Hazlemere, only minutes from local shops and amenities.

The development is set within its own beautifully tended private gardens, while benefitting from the convenient proximity to High Wycombe, approximately three miles away.

This bustling market town offers a varied selection of high street shops, markets, theatres, and the popular Eden Centre. High Wycombe is well placed for M40, M4 and M25 transport links and benefits from the mainline station with a frequent rail service direct to London Marylebone (2.1 miles away).

Hazlemere is surrounded by the beautiful unspoiled Chiltern countryside, an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, including the quaint historic village of West Wycombe, where characterful cafes provide the perfect location for afternoon tea and cake. For enjoying a stroll along the picturesque Thames River, nearby Marlow is an idyllic town, also boasting many boutique shops and acclaimed eateries.

Interior:

The entrance to this delightful apartment, which is situated discreetly on the second floor, comprises a generously sized hallway equipped with a secure intercom entry system. The harmonious and well-balanced layout offered by the apartment creates a spacious feel throughout, which is enhanced by the abundance of natural light thanks to its large windows.

The apartment boasts a generously sized open plan living / dining room, which is perfect for both dining and relaxing - there being ample space for a large table and chairs and soft furnishings.

The living / dining room provides convenient access to the smart, well presented fitted kitchen via double doors. The modern kitchen is equipped with integrated appliances including a grill and microwave and a wipe clean hob with an extractor hood above. There are extensive work tops and multiple high and low-level cupboards. The kitchen is fully tiled and benefits from a large window providing a wide panorama over the surrounding neighbourhood.

There is electric heating throughout the apartment via slimline storage heaters and the windows are double glazed in every room, making this a snug and cosy property.

The apartment has a well-sized double bedroom, benefitting from a floor-to-ceiling quadruple wardrobe with folding mirrored doors.

The spacious bathroom is situated off the hallway and is equipped with a modern three-piece suite comprising a bathtub with a shower attachment above. The bathroom benefits from being half tiled. It has under-vanity storage, a mirror and a heated towel rail. Two handy walk-in cupboards in the corridor provide further storage options.

The apartment is situated on the second floor of this well-maintained development which benefits from both lift and stair access to all floors. There are safety alarm pulls in the bedroom, the bathroom and the lounge / dining room for added comfort and security.

Exterior:

Hughenden Court provides beautiful and expansive communal gardens allowing residents to enjoy some outdoor peace and tranquillity. The gardens comprise a neatly presented open lawned area flanked with beautiful flower beds and terraced areas.

Inside there is a spacious communal lounge with comfortable seating, providing a welcoming environment for residents to socialise together or with friends and family if they wish, or take part in the planned activities.

Other facilities available for residents include a well-equipped laundry room with washer/ dryers and a spacious guest accommodation. Hughenden Court is managed by a site manager during office hours and has private parking for both residents and their visitors. A lift and several flights of stairs serve the upper floors of the development.
